Ghanaians Should Get Ready to Experience Severe Hardship and Suffering Under Akufo-Addo – Haruna Iddrisu forewarns

Minority Leader, Haruna Iddrisu is forewarning Ghanaians to get ready to experience severe hardship under the second term of President Akufo-Addo.

According to him, the 2021 budget statement presented by Majority Lader, Osei Kyei-Mensah-Bonsu in parliament yesterday has no hope for Ghanaians especially when new taxes have been introduced.

Speaking in an interview with Citi News, Haruna Iddrissu said the severity of the suffering and hardship Ghanaians will go through the kind courtesy of the new taxes will be unprecedented.

“There is no hope. Ghanaians must brace themselves up for increased hardship and increased suffering because it means that there will be petro hikes with ESLA that they described a few years ago as a nuisance tax. But they are back to it as a credible source of revenue which is a lack of principle.”

“The workers of Ghana will be disappointed because the minimum wage has not been determined, public sector wage has not been determined and it is the first time this has happened since 2014. So it means that compensation is likely to erode any gains that we are likely to make but at least now debt to GDP is 276%.”
